TOP quality baby clothes, toys and equipment will be on offer as the NCT (National Childbirth Trust) holds a Nearly New Sale in Dorchester.

The Weymouth and Dorchester branch of the NCT is running the sale from 10am to noon at the Corn Exchange on Saturday, March 22.

Sale co-ordinator Emma Macdonald said: “NCT Nearly New Sales are a simple idea, with so many benefits.

“Some parents sell items they no longer need, others hunt for bargains, and whether you’re buying, selling or both you can be sure you’re helping to support other parents in Dorset by funding the NCT charity’s vital work.

“The sales are open to everyone, not just NCT members, so we hope to see you there.”

Recent research by the NCT shows that 50 per cent of new parents had bought second hand baby or toddler items in the last six months as the economic climate forces families to tighten their belts.

The trust says that cash-strapped parents or parents-to-be can save an average of around 70 per cent on what items would cost brand new by buying them secondhand.
